摘要
In the blue-violet crystals of lithium bis{meso-oxolane-3,4-diolato(2-)}cuprate tetrahydrate, Li2[Cu(C4H6O3)2] . 4H2O (1) (P2(1)/c, a = 706.2(4), b = 1114.0(6), c = 95 8.3(5) pm, beta = 107.67(3)-degrees, Z = 2, R(W) = 0.022), square-planar coordinated copper(II) ions are bound to twofold deprotonated anhydro-erythrol ligands (Cu-O 194.36(17) and 191.83(17) pm). The oxygen ligator atoms of the mononuclear cuprate ions are bound to lithium ions or they are acceptors in asymmetrical hydrogen bonds. Trinuclear tris-{mu-propanetriolato(3-)}tricuprate ions with triply deprotonated glycerol as ligands are present in the deep blue columns of LiCuC3H5O3.6H2O (2) (P3BARc1, a = 1278.8(6), c = 2 420.5(12) pm, Z = 12, R(W) = 0.059), which has been prepared for the first time by Bullnheimer [2]. The copper(II) ions in 2 are also bound to alkoxide oxygen atoms in square-planar coordination (Cu-O 190.7(7) and 192.4(8), Cu-mu-O 196.6(6) and 195.0(7) pm). The hydrogen bond system and the content of channels parallel [001] are described in terms of a disorder model.
